Backblaze Starts Tracking Hot Drives As World Preps For Rising Global Temperatures

The Register, Tuesday, November 14,2023

Quarterly stats to show when units exceed manufacturer max temp

Cloud storage and backup provider Backblaze has released its latest drive statistics report, introducing tracking of temperature data for drives and failure rates for each datacenter.

Backblaze, which focuses on cloud-based storage services, issues regular reports on the health and status of the fleet of storage devices under its management, providing useful insights into drive behavior.

For the calendar Q3 Drive Stats report, the company looked at temperature data for its drives and found that a small number of devices had exceeded the manufacturer's maximum level for at least one day.
